This result reflects the proportion of your body that is fat versus lean mass (muscle, bone, water, etc.).
Category | Men (% Body Fat) | Women (% Body Fat) |
---|---|---|
Essential Fat | 2–5% | 10–13% |
Athletes | 6–13% | 14–20% |
Fitness | 14–17% | 21–24% |
Average | 18–24% | 25–31% |
Obese | 25%+ | 32%+ |
You can be a “normal weight” but have a high body fat percentage—a condition known as skinny fat. That’s why tracking body fat % gives you a much better understanding of your health, strength, and fitness than weight or BMI alone.
